Whether you're an art lover, a collector, or just starting to explore, these galleries and events focus on showcasing local art, offering a diverse range of mediums and styles to suit all tastes.
While there are many other opportunities to enjoy art in the area, we’re focusing specifically on events and venues that feature almost entirely local artists.
Gallery 24 – Cooperative gallery featuring diverse mediums and styles.
Threshold Arts – Contemporary gallery showcasing regional talent and their online market partner Rochester Makers Market
SEMVA Art Gallery – Local cooperative with paintings, jewelry, and more.
Winona Arts Center – A vibrant space for local exhibitions and events.
Bluff Country Artists Gallery – Representing 70+ regional artists in Spring Grove.
Lanesboro Arts – Showcasing over 100 regional artists through exhibits.

Southeast Minnesota, including cities like Rochester, Austin, Owatonna. Faribault, Northfield, Red Wing, and Winona , is a vibrant region known for its rich cultural heritage and natural beauty. This area fosters creativity through a supportive community, local events, and access to diverse artistic landscapes.
Whether nestled in the heart of Rochester or the charming small towns surrounding it, local artists thrive here, drawing inspiration from the area's history, landscape, and tight-knit community.
Southeast Minnesota is not just a place to live, but a place to create, connect, and share your work with others who value local talent and craftsmanship.

Thinking about taking your creativity further? Whether you're new to the area, a hobbyist exploring new skills, a side hustler growing your craft, or a seasoned pro looking to share your expertise, there’s a place for you here!
Check out these resources for entrepreneurial creatives whether you’re crafting, baking, or beyond :
Support at any stage of your crafting journey:
SEMAC (Southeastern Minnesota Arts Council) – Funding, resources, and community for creative entrepreneurs.
MN Cottage Food – Support and guidelines for food-based entrepreneurs.
Your County and State Fair – Opportunities to showcase handmade and homegrown goods.
Explore Minnesota – Events and entrepreneurial opportunities around Minnesota, including SE MN.
City Art Programs – Like Red Wing Arts, Lanesboro Arts, offering platforms for local creators.
Looking to turn your hobby into a business?
Local Chamber of Commerce – Networking, business support, and resources for entrepreneurs.
Educational Institutions – Colleges and trade schools offering business support, workshops, and resources.
Small Business Support Groups – Minnesota Small Business Development Center (SBDC), MN Small Business Administration (SBA), Minnesota Department of Employment and Economic Development (DEED), Creative MN, Grow Minnesota!, and more.
